Data company IDC has published its expectations for the wearables market in the coming years. Particular attention was paid to VR/AR headsets, which, according to IDC, have not yet achieved a complete breakthrough.
The American data and analytics company IDC expects sales of VR/AR headsets to increase in the coming years. However, its numbers show that other wearables will continue to dominate in total units.

The market for VR/AR headsets is not easy. In the second quarter of this year, sales of wearable devices fell by almost half compared to the previous year. IDC sees the economic climate and outdated hardware among manufacturers as the main causes. There will hardly be as many headsets sold this year as in 2017.
However, according to IDC, this trend will not continue. Advances in VR/AR at companies like Meta and Qualcomm are helping with headset development. The competition such as Apple, Sony, ByteDance and MediaTek does not stand still and competition is of course often good for development.
IDC expects growth of more than 45 percent for 2024, also thanks to Apple’s Vision Pro. More than thirty million VR/AR headsets are expected to be shipped by 2027, almost four times as many as this year.

On the other hand, there is a much larger market for other wearables such as earphones and smartwatches. In the second quarter of this year it grew by 8.5 percent. The overall market value declined due to lower prices and various discounts from retailers.
Larger companies now also have competition from smaller niche companies, thanks to specific things like connected rings to collect certain data. Around 520 million wearables will be shipped this year, an increase of more than five percent compared to last year. IDC expects more than 625 million units by 2027.
The top three are still earbuds, smartwatches and smart bracelets. More than 381 million of the first units alone would be delivered worldwide by 2027 and the total number of smartwatches would easily exceed the 210 million mark this year.
For now, these are numbers that VR/AR headsets can only dream of. But the prognosis is positive and in the world of technology things can sometimes happen quickly. For example, these IDC predictions don’t mention the military research into AR headsets that Microsoft is conducting.
